Comprehensive Prediction Analysis:
Leeds United have performed far better at home than away this season, securing 11 of their 14 points at Elland Road. They claimed an impressive 3-1 victory over 4th-placed Chelsea at home midweek. Despite lingering on the brink of the relegation zone and manager Daniel Farke's position being under intense scrutiny, Leeds have shown remarkable resilience in their last two matches—defeating Chelsea and coming from two goals down to draw with Manchester City.
Liverpool's performance this season has been highly disappointing. Beyond the poor form of attackers Salah and Isak, the decline of defenders Virgil van Dijk and Ibrahima Konaté has effectively ended their title challenge. Their recent 1-1 draw with Sunderland, secured only by an own goal from Florian Wirtz, highlighted manager Arne Slot's struggle to adjust tactics, with the team still mired in a slump.
